The boo.com lowdown

Where?

2 min walk from Tivoli Gardens, central station and city centre.

What?

A new hostel with 250 beds.

Anything else you need to know?

This hostel has its own bar, lounge and café/restaurant. Breakfast and bed linen are provided at a further charge. Internet access available. Reception is open 24 hours. Lockers and luggage storage provided.
